NPCI International Payments Ltd (NIPL) and Maldives Monetary Authority (MMA) have successfully integrated the Maldives' instant payment system 'Favara' with India's Unified Payments Interface (UPI). This enables real-time fund transfers from Maldives to UPI-enabled Indian bank accounts, marking a significant step in cross-border digital financial connectivity and bilateral economic cooperation.
